Web1 Basics. Basically, we've got three things to go through: automatic mesh motion. layer addition/removal. sliding interface. Please note that in most cases, the sliding interface and layer addition/removal will also require mesh motion, but it needs to be set up such that it works with the mesh modifier.

WebFeb 4, 2016 · ANS. Generally, triangular meshes in 2D (tetrahedral meshes in 3D) are more quickly generated in the ANSYS meshing tool. And the deformation-stretching of cells too, which is a part of moving mesh type analysis, occurs best with unstructured cells, although there would be a higher trade off with computational time.
